You can't imagine how stupid the whole world has grown nowadays.
Nikolai Gogol
ShareWTF𝕏

Interpretation

What this quote means

This quote reflects a cynical view of societal decline and the perception of increasing foolishness in the world.

Nikolai Gogol's quote encapsulates a humorous yet critical observation about the state of the world. It suggests that the speaker feels that there is a noticeable decline in common sense and intelligence among people today, which can be seen as a reflection of frustration with societal behaviors or trends. While the statement is somewhat exaggerated, it encourages readers to reflect on the irrationalities they observe in daily life and how these may contribute to an overall sense of disillusionment.
